Searched refs:write_urb (Results 1 - 25 of 27) sorted by relevance

12

/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/usb/serial/
H A Dir-usb.c300 kfree (port->write_urb->transfer_buffer);
301 port->write_urb->transfer_buffer = buffer;
302 port->write_urb->transfer_buffer_length = buffer_size;
355 transfer_buffer = port->write_urb->transfer_buffer;
371 port->write_urb,
375 port->write_urb->transfer_buffer,
380 port->write_urb->transfer_flags = URB_ZERO_PACKET;
382 result = usb_submit_urb (port->write_urb, GFP_ATOMIC);
552 transfer_buffer = port->write_urb->transfer_buffer;
556 port->write_urb,
[all...]
H A Dsafe_serial.c238 dbg ("safe_write port: %p %d urb: %p count: %d", port, port->number, port->write_urb,
241 if (!port->write_urb) {
246 dbg ("safe_write write_urb: %d transfer_buffer_length",
247 port->write_urb->transfer_buffer_length);
249 if (!port->write_urb->transfer_buffer_length) {
273 data = port->write_urb->transfer_buffer;
295 port->write_urb->transfer_buffer_length = packet_length;
297 port->write_urb->transfer_buffer_length = count;
300 usb_serial_debug_data(debug, &port->dev, __FUNCTION__, count, port->write_urb->transfer_buffer);
304 unsigned char *cp = port->write_urb
[all...]
H A Ddigi_acceleport.c651 while( oob_port->write_urb->status == -EINPROGRESS
667 memcpy( oob_port->write_urb->transfer_buffer, buf, len );
668 oob_port->write_urb->transfer_buffer_length = len;
669 oob_port->write_urb->dev = port->serial->dev;
671 if( (ret=usb_submit_urb(oob_port->write_urb, GFP_ATOMIC)) == 0 ) {
710 unsigned char *data = port->write_urb->transfer_buffer;
726 while( (port->write_urb->status == -EINPROGRESS
751 port->write_urb->transfer_buffer_length
755 port->write_urb->transfer_buffer_length = len;
757 port->write_urb
[all...]
H A Dkobil_sct.c261 // allocate write_urb
262 if (!port->write_urb) {
263 dbg("%s - port %d Allocating port->write_urb", __FUNCTION__, port->number);
264 port->write_urb = usb_alloc_urb(0, GFP_KERNEL);
265 if (!port->write_urb) {
272 // allocate memory for write_urb transfer buffer
273 port->write_urb->transfer_buffer = kmalloc(write_urb_transfer_buffer_length, GFP_KERNEL);
274 if (! port->write_urb->transfer_buffer) {
276 usb_free_urb(port->write_urb);
277 port->write_urb
[all...]
H A Dcyberjack.c174 usb_clear_halt(port->serial->dev, port->write_urb->pipe);
198 usb_kill_urb(port->write_urb);
258 memcpy (port->write_urb->transfer_buffer, priv->wrbuf, length );
262 usb_fill_bulk_urb(port->write_urb, serial->dev,
264 port->write_urb->transfer_buffer, length,
271 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
434 memcpy (port->write_urb->transfer_buffer, priv->wrbuf + priv->wrsent,
439 usb_fill_bulk_urb(port->write_urb, port->serial->dev,
441 port->write_urb->transfer_buffer, length,
448 result = usb_submit_urb(port->write_urb, GFP_ATOMI
[all...]
H A Dgeneric.c166 usb_kill_urb(port->write_urb);
204 memcpy (port->write_urb->transfer_buffer, buf, count);
205 data = port->write_urb->transfer_buffer;
209 usb_fill_bulk_urb (port->write_urb, serial->dev,
212 port->write_urb->transfer_buffer, count,
219 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
259 chars = port->write_urb->transfer_buffer_length;
H A Domninet.c250 struct omninet_header *header = (struct omninet_header *) wport->write_urb->transfer_buffer;
272 memcpy (wport->write_urb->transfer_buffer + OMNINET_DATAOFFSET, buf, count);
274 usb_serial_debug_data(debug, &port->dev, __FUNCTION__, count, wport->write_urb->transfer_buffer);
282 wport->write_urb->transfer_buffer_length = 64;
284 wport->write_urb->dev = serial->dev;
285 result = usb_submit_urb(wport->write_urb, GFP_ATOMIC);
334 usb_kill_urb(wport->write_urb);
H A Daircable.c234 memcpy(port->write_urb->transfer_buffer, buf,
241 port->write_urb->transfer_buffer);
242 port->write_urb->transfer_buffer_length = count + HCI_HEADER_LENGTH;
243 port->write_urb->dev = port->serial->dev;
244 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
436 port->write_urb->transfer_buffer_length = 1;
437 port->write_urb->dev = port->serial->dev;
438 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
H A Dipw.c361 usb_kill_urb(port->write_urb);
405 usb_fill_bulk_urb(port->write_urb, dev,
407 port->write_urb->transfer_buffer,
412 ret = usb_submit_urb(port->write_urb, GFP_ATOMIC);
H A Dpl2303.c378 count = pl2303_buf_get(priv->buf, port->write_urb->transfer_buffer,
391 port->write_urb->transfer_buffer);
393 port->write_urb->transfer_buffer_length = count;
394 port->write_urb->dev = port->serial->dev;
395 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
673 usb_kill_urb(port->write_urb);
700 usb_clear_halt(serial->dev, port->write_urb->pipe);
1098 port->write_urb->transfer_buffer_length = 1;
1099 port->write_urb->dev = port->serial->dev;
1100 result = usb_submit_urb(port->write_urb, GFP_ATOMI
[all...]
H A Dkeyspan_pda.c575 memcpy (port->write_urb->transfer_buffer, buf, count);
577 port->write_urb->transfer_buffer_length = count;
581 port->write_urb->dev = port->serial->dev;
582 rc = usb_submit_urb(port->write_urb, GFP_ATOMIC);
708 usb_kill_urb(port->write_urb);
H A Dipaq.c656 port->write_urb->transfer_buffer = port->bulk_out_buffer;
658 port->bulk_out_size = port->write_urb->transfer_buffer_length = URBDATA_SIZE;
719 usb_kill_urb(port->write_urb);
824 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
840 struct urb *urb = port->write_urb;
860 usb_fill_bulk_urb(port->write_urb, serial->dev,
862 port->write_urb->transfer_buffer, count, ipaq_write_bulk_callback,
885 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
H A Dwhiteheat.c469 buf_size = port->write_urb->transfer_buffer_length;
502 command_port->write_urb->complete = command_port_write_callback;
632 usb_clear_halt(port->serial->dev, port->write_urb->pipe);
1113 transfer_buffer = (__u8 *)command_port->write_urb->transfer_buffer;
1116 command_port->write_urb->transfer_buffer_length = datasize + 1;
1117 command_port->write_urb->dev = port->serial->dev;
1118 retval = usb_submit_urb (command_port->write_urb, GFP_KERNEL);
H A Dusb-serial.c578 usb_kill_urb(port->write_urb);
587 usb_free_urb(port->write_urb);
886 port->write_urb = usb_alloc_urb(0, GFP_KERNEL);
887 if (!port->write_urb) {
899 usb_fill_bulk_urb (port->write_urb, dev,
1020 usb_free_urb(port->write_urb);
H A Dti_usb_3410_5052.c615 usb_clear_halt(dev, port->write_urb->pipe);
689 usb_kill_urb(port->write_urb);
1315 port->write_urb->transfer_buffer,
1327 usb_serial_debug_data(debug, &port->dev, __FUNCTION__, count, port->write_urb->transfer_buffer);
1329 usb_fill_bulk_urb(port->write_urb, port->serial->dev,
1332 port->write_urb->transfer_buffer, count,
1335 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
H A Dio_edgeport.c113 struct urb *write_urb; /* write URB for this port */ member in struct:edgeport_port
898 edge_port->write_urb = usb_alloc_urb (0, GFP_KERNEL);
901 if (!edge_port->write_urb) {
1070 usb_kill_urb(edge_port->write_urb);
1072 if (edge_port->write_urb) {
1074 kfree(edge_port->write_urb->transfer_buffer);
1075 usb_free_urb(edge_port->write_urb);
1076 edge_port->write_urb = NULL;
1220 // get a pointer to the write_urb
1221 urb = edge_port->write_urb;
[all...]
H A Dcp2101.c327 usb_kill_urb(port->write_urb);
339 usb_kill_urb(port->write_urb);
H A Dmos7840.c177 struct urb *write_urb; /* write URB for this port */ member in struct:moschip_port
838 usb_clear_halt(serial->dev, port->write_urb->pipe);
1240 if (mos7840_port->write_urb) {
1242 usb_kill_urb(mos7840_port->write_urb);
1267 if (mos7840_port->write_urb) {
1270 if (mos7840_port->write_urb->transfer_buffer != NULL) {
1271 kfree(mos7840_port->write_urb->transfer_buffer);
1273 usb_free_urb(mos7840_port->write_urb);
H A Dio_ti.c2046 usb_clear_halt (dev, port->write_urb->pipe);
2102 usb_kill_urb(port->write_urb);
2172 port->write_urb->transfer_buffer,
2184 usb_serial_debug_data(debug, &port->dev, __FUNCTION__, count, port->write_urb->transfer_buffer);
2187 usb_fill_bulk_urb (port->write_urb, port->serial->dev,
2190 port->write_urb->transfer_buffer, count,
2195 result = usb_submit_urb(port->write_urb, GFP_ATOMIC);
H A Dbelkin_sa.c246 usb_kill_urb(port->write_urb);
H A Dftdi_sio.c975 if (port->write_urb) {
976 usb_free_urb (port->write_urb);
977 port->write_urb = NULL;
H A Dkl5kusb105.c461 usb_kill_urb(port->write_urb);
H A Dmct_u232.c460 usb_kill_urb(port->write_urb);
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/usb/image/
H A Dmdc800.c153 struct urb * write_urb; member in struct:mdc800_data
374 * The write_urb callback function
524 mdc800->write_urb,
573 usb_kill_urb(mdc800->write_urb);
680 usb_kill_urb(mdc800->write_urb);
855 memcpy (mdc800->write_urb->transfer_buffer, mdc800->in,8);
856 mdc800->write_urb->dev = mdc800->dev;
857 if (usb_submit_urb (mdc800->write_urb, GFP_KERNEL))
859 err ("submitting write urb fails (status=%i)", mdc800->write_urb->status);
867 usb_kill_urb(mdc800->write_urb);
[all...]
/net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/include/linux/usb/
H A Dserial.h51 * @write_urb: pointer to the bulk out struct urb for this port.
86 struct urb * write_urb; member in struct:usb_serial_port

Completed in 209 milliseconds

12